3-Oxotaraxer-14-en-30-al ( 1 ), a new taraxastane-type triterpene, together with 14 known compounds, taraxerone ( 2 ), 3-epiursolic acid ( 3 ), 2 α ,3 β -dihydroxyurs-12-en-28-oic acid ( 4 ), lupeol ( 5 ), betulinic acid ( 6 ), casticin ( 7 ), artemetin ( 8 ), luteolin ( 9 ), 4-hydroxybenzoic acid ( 10 ), docosanoic acid ( 11 ), tetracosanoic acid ( 12 ), cerotic acid ( 13 ), β -sitosterol ( 14 ), and β -daucosterol ( 15 ), was isolated from the leaves and twigs of Vitex trifolia var. simplicifolia . Compounds 2 – 6 were found for the first time in this plant. Their structures were established by spectroscopic analysis, including 2D-NMR techniques. Cytotoxic activities of compounds 3 , and 5 – 10 were tested on the three cancer cell lines, PANC-1, K562, and BxPC-3. Results revealed that 7 exhibited cytotoxicity against PANC-1, K562, and BxPC-3, with IC 50 values of 4.67, 0.72, and 4.01 μg/ml, respectively, whereas 8 was inactive against these cancer cell lines. The structure activity relationship of compound 7 and 8 indicated that the 3′-OH group in polymethoxyflavonoids is essential for antitumor activity.
